
Werner Herzog’s vision of madness starring Klaus Kinski and Jack Nicholson
In an imagined 1980 version of The Lighthouse, director Werner Herzog explores madness, isolation, and the cruelty of nature. Klaus Kinski stars as Thomas Wake, a tyrannical and unhinged lighthouse keeper whose obsession with power and the sea slowly consumes him. Jack Nicholson plays Ephraim Winslow, a troubled drifter whose sanity erodes under relentless labor, alcohol, and Wake’s psychological torment. Shot with Herzog’s signature realism and existential intensity, this version transforms The Lighthouse into a raw battle of wills between two men trapped at the edge of the world, where nature is indifferent and madness is inevitable.
